Frequently Asked Questions about New Carlisle

What type of rentals are currently available in New Carlisle?

There are currently 68 Apartments for Rent in New Carlisle, OH with pricing that ranges from $625 to $2,837. There are also 37 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in New Carlisle ranging from $550 to $2,700.

What is the current price range for Rental Homes in New Carlisle?

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in New Carlisle ranges from $550 to $2,700 with an average monthly rent of $1,481.
